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os was widely used an building material in the 1930s and into the 1970s. It was used in insulation for pipes, fireproofing materials, plasters and cements, car brakes, and more. Exposure to this dangerous material could cause serious medical conditions, such as mesothelioma or other respiratory illnesses.

A New York mesothelioma attorney can assist victims in obtaining comp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to choose the right lawyer for this type of claim.

Find a specialist

Asbest fibers can be inhaled when they are mined and processed. This can cause asbestosis, lung cancer, and mesothelioma. People who are exposed to the mineral face higher risk of exposure than others however, even those who do not deal with it directly may inhale it. This kind of exposure, also known as secondary exposure can affect anyone who is around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es relatives that wash the uniforms of the worker and anyone living in the same home. This can also happen in military bases and on ships where workers wear the same uniforms for long periods of time.

Asbestos is a concern for people who work in shipyards, construction and mills as well as in insulation, mining and other industries. This was especially the case in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when old buildings were demolished or renovated as well as when building materials were damaged. materials. Even these days, the demolition and remodeling in older buildings could release asbestos into the atmosphere.

It could take a long time between exposure to asbestos and the onset of mesothelioma, or other symptoms. It is therefore important to consult a doctor when you've been exposed to asbestos or think you might be suffering from any of the diseases that are associated with asbestos.

Your doctor will examine your lungs, and ask you about any asbestos-related history of work.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related illness, they could refer you to a specialist for more tests. Asbestos-related illnesses can be detected through chest X-rays and CT scans. However, they might not show up in these tests.

These diseases can appear in the lungs, abdomen (abdomen) and heart. It is extremely r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best way to prevent asbestos exposure is to stay clear of all types of dust and to never smoke or work in an industry that could use asbestos. Others say this is impossible and that people should be checked regularly for symptoms of asbestos-related diseases.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os, which is a fibrous material, is used in many industrial applications because of its heat resistance as well as its flexibility and strength. Unfortunately, asbestos also causes a variety of serious health problems, such as mesothelioma and lung cancer. These conditions are painful, debilitating, and can be fatal. Patients who have been exposed to asbestos could be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it can cover medical bills as well as lost wages, home expenses for health care, and more.

Workers who have come into contact with asbestos should immediately report any symptoms of illness. This is especially important for construction workers who are frequently exposed asbestos when renovating old buildings. These buildings were built before asbestos was recognized as a carcinogen that could cause harm and could contain unsafe levels of the material.

Exposure to asbestos can cause various ailments, and the signs of these diseases typically do not appear for 25 to 50 years following the exposure. Therefore, anyone who has been exposed to asbestos should have regular health checks with a doctor. This is the best way to avoid the development of asbestos-related illnesses or to recognize any early warning signs.

Certain individuals are at greater risk of being exposed to asbestos than others. Navy veterans, for instance, may have been exposed to asbestos while serving on ships and other military facilities. In addition, those working in shipyard repair, heating system repair, construction, or the automotive industry have been exposed to asbestos.

Many different agencies set rules and regulations that employers must adhere to regarding asbestos lawyer in the workplace. If you believe your employer isn't adhering to these standards, call the Occupational Safety and Health Administration for more information or to request an inspection.

Some veterans who served in the United States Armed Forces are also eligible for disability compensation. Eligible veterans are able to make a claim with the VA for benefits related to asbestos exposure during their service.

File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health and employment records in order to establish a timeline for your asbestos exposure. Then, they will construct your case by assembling evidence that proves that you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ure led to harm. The complaint will be sent to each defendant and they will have 30 days in which to respond. Defendants will often deny their responsibility and might even attempt to blame someone else. This is why you need a team of attorneys who is able to deal with these claims.

When your attorney has all the necessary documentation they will file your asbestos case. They will file it within the state court system that best suits your case. During this time,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ery, where they will exchange information regarding the case with the opposing party. If a trial is ordered and they are required to represent you at the trial. However, most cases resolve through an asbestos settlement.

asbestos lawyer litigation is distinct from other personal injury cases and that's why it's crucial to hire mesothelioma specialists. They have access to a database which shows the patients the asbestos-related products they used in their work. This helps patients to identify the products at fault for their exposure.

They also know which companies are accountable for your exposure. This includes the manufacturers of asbestos-containing items that you handled, and even the owners of buildings that contain as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
